Catherine Aspden was born in 1831 in Ireland; most likely this was when the family was enroute to America. It was not uncommon for emigrees from Scotland and England to start the process in Northern Ireland. She was a daughter of Henry Aspden and Ann Whitaker who were from Blackburn, Lancashire, England. Catherine married Thomas Hamilton a wire cutter who was born in Ireland. They had five children and resided in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. She passed away February 2,1883 and was buried at Mount Vernon Cemetery, Philadelphia. Thomas died October 10, 1888 and was interred beside her.
